Slime Shop is our collaboration with miniature world makers Aleia Murawski and Sam Copeland. These two geniuses created a tiny grocery store by hand for snails and we turned it into a 500 piece puzzle! Trés chic!

500 pieces

Random cut — every piece different than the next!

How big?

 

Completed, this puzzle is 25 x 18 inches.

 The Slime Shop box is 14.25 x 9 x 2 inches.

What's in the box?

 

500 pieces, a reusable resealable bag, bonus double-sided fold-out poster.

The snails are real and all of the other details in this image were made meticulously by hand. For more info about the snails you see here please refer an an interview with Al Dente (the snail) on the back of our box.

Our puzzle die lines are exclusive to Le Puzz and are random cut meaning every piece is different than the next! Detail above of the 500 pc. die line to give you a sense of the kinds of pieces you might encounter. Our 500 piece puzzles are extra-thick — quite possibly the thickest puzzle pieces on the market to date.

 

 

The photo on this puzzle is titled "Al Dente's Grocery Trip" by Aleia Murawski and Sam Copeland. Read more about Aleia, Sam and their snails at aleia.net
